Transaction 5877ee2aa40143207d27af5bd8f6539e521283c16b08c656f6c8caf027e8fa05

1 Input
2 Outputs
  • 5877ee2aa40143207d27af5bd8f6539e521283c16b08c656f6c8caf027e8fa05:0
  • value  173626
    address  1Huh5LT6u2S1pgropwHyCGqjPSK3ZK3uHD
  • 5877ee2aa40143207d27af5bd8f6539e521283c16b08c656f6c8caf027e8fa05:1
  • value  3600000
    address  36prvUmZNU2kVZsRq8KBAttoYQwTCeJMKE